Haiti - Justice : Update on the cases Emile Giordani and Guiteau Toussaint 01/09/2011 11:22:12 In the case of notary Emile Giordani found dead Saturday, August 27 in a ravine at the Canape Vert after being kidnapped on August 26, Sonel Jean Francois says indicates that no one was arrested, but there are tracks "The investigation into the death of the notary Giordani began since Saturday when we discovered the body in a ravine, the observation was made, there are people who have been interviewed, samples of fingerprints have been done, then we we went to the notary who has been sacked, now we do research to see how we can catch the perpetrators and co-authors of this crime. We also found the presence of a car, a BMW, according to information that relatives of a notary gave us this is the car of the notary, it is in the trunk of this car they put the notary after the kidnapping [...] no one was arrested so far, we are currently on some tracks, but so far no one has been apprehended [...]" In the case of the murder of banker Guiteau Toussaint, who died June 12 https://www.haitilibre.com/en/news-3152-haiti-insecurity-the-banker-guiteau-toussaint-shot-dead-sunday-evening.html Commissioner of the Government indicates that the case progresses "the prosecution is progressing on the case of the death of Toussaint Guyto, this file was referred to the office of instruction, I sent a Supplementary Submission to the judge and through this submission I sent him some information supplements and now I am going to send other information supplements, because the Central Directorate of Judicial Police (DCPJ) just sent us further information, we will continue to send this information to the judge as part of another Supplementary Submission. So it's a file that advance, there are several people who were arrested in connection with this but what is clear is that today the DCPJ gave us more information and we will refer other persons directly to the office of instruction."
